The REO Guide: 10 Steps to Buying a Bank-Owned Home

PennyMac

Some homebuyers are intimidated by foreclosed and bank-owned homes because they often require more renovations — and a different type of negotiation — than other options on the market. Whether you’re buying the home to live in or as an investment, these 10 steps should help set you up for success with bank-owned properties.
